AI Summary

  • Allows employees entitled to vote at primary or general elections in Arizona to be absent from employment on election day or during in-person early voting for voting purposes.

  • Permits employees to be absent for up to five consecutive hours at the beginning or end of their workshift to vote, with no penalty or wage deduction.

  • Requires employees to notify their employer of the voting absence before election day, and allows employers to specify which hours the employee may be absent.

  • Makes it a class 2 misdemeanor for employers to refuse voting time off, penalize employees for voting absences, reduce wages, or otherwise violate the voting absence provisions.
